Why Gym Lovers Get Underarm Irritation

Before you pick the perfect gift, it helps to know the problem. Underarm irritant dermatitis is a type of skin irritation. It happens when your skin barrier gets stressed by things like friction, sweat, or strong ingredients.

Common triggers for gym lovers include:

  • Tight seams that rub during lifting or running
  • Rough fabrics that trap sweat and heat
  • Deodorants with heavy fragrance or strong alcohol
  • Shaving followed by harsh products
  • Not letting skin dry fully after a shower or workout

Soft, Smart Fabrics: Workout Clothes For Sensitive Skin

Clothing can help or hurt sensitive underarms. When you shop for workout clothes for sensitive skin, look for pieces that feel smooth and light, not scratchy or stiff.

Helpful fabric features include:

  • Seamless or flat seams. These reduce rubbing in the underarm and side areas.
  • Soft, moisture wicking fabric. This pulls sweat off the skin so it dries faster.
  • Breathable fibers. Look for mesh panels or light knits in sweat prone spots.
  • Tagless designs. Neck and side tags can scratch sensitive skin.

Deodorant For Sensitive Underarms: What To Look For

For many active people, deodorant is the main trigger. If you want gifts for people who sweat a lot and also react to deodorant, ingredient lists matter.

Common irritants include:

  • Strong fragrance blends
  • High levels of alcohol
  • Certain preservatives and dyes
  • Harsh essential oils in high amounts
